Bodrum Weather
The temperatures in Bodrum start to dramatically rise in May, you can expect temperatures during the summer months to be in the region of 25 degrees and over. During the height of summer (June, July, August) it is not unusual for the temperatures to be in excess of 30 degrees! This is ideal for lazing on the beach and fantastic for those of you that like to cool off in the sea, pool or enjoy watersports. We would certainly recommend booking accommodation with air-conditioning during these times. The Meltemi is a pleasant, cool refreshing wind that blows in from the Aegean during the summer months, May to October.

Weather in Bodrum April & May

The months of April and May provides a very pleasant time to visit the Bodrum region. Temperatures range from the low to mid 20's, you can expect sunny days, blue skies. This is the ideal time to visit if you like walking/hiking. Make your way through the lush green hills and experience blossoming spring.

Autumn weather in Bodrum

You can expect around 8 hours of sun a day in Autumn, the water is still warm enough for swimming. Average temperatures of up to 24C are perfect for sightseeing. Tourist crowds are reduced making it easier to find a place on the beaches and provides an opportunity to enjoy a quieter break and you should be able to take advantage of both cheaper flights and accommodation.

Winter weather in Bodrum, November to March

Winter in Bodrum brings cooler temperatures, in the region of 10c and below. The majority of the rain falls between December and January and can bring storms.
